Harness has unveiled a significant update to its platform, integrating generative AI to streamline the enterprise software development process. This update introduces a suite of AI agents designed to automate various stages of the software development lifecycle, including coding, testing, and deployment. The new features aim to reduce the time developers spend on repetitive tasks, allowing them to focus on more creative problem-solving activities.
The AI agents include an AI DevOps Engineer, a QA Assistant, and an AI Code Generation tool, all aimed at enhancing productivity. Harness's CEO, Jyoti Bansal, emphasizes that these advancements could lead to a productivity increase of up to 50% for development teams. By leveraging AI, the platform not only automates coding but also improves testing efficiency, potentially reducing test writing time by 80%.
